Borealis announces new Executive Vice President for Polyolefins

Borealis, a leading provider of innovative, value creating plastics solutions, announces the appointment of Lorenzo Delorenzi as Executive Vice President for its Polyolefins business group and member of the Executive Board, effective immediately.Delorenzi vacates the position of Vice President for the Business Unit Pipe, where he led a successful turnaround of the business. Prior to joining Borealis, he held senior commercial and management positions within Tetrapak, one of the world's leading packaging organisations, including Global Director for Strategic Marketing and Managing Director of the PET Division. Before TetraPak, he also held key sales and marketing positions at well known companies such as Du Pont de Nemours, Unilever and A.C. Nielsen, thereby bringing a wealth of management and sales and marketing experience to his new role. Delorenzi has a Degree in Applied Business Economics from the University of Louvain in Belgium. He is 45 years old, an Italian citizen and has 3 children.

"We welcome Lorenzo to our leadership team," says Borealis Chief Executive Mark Garrett. "Based on the strong leadership of the Pipe Business Unit, we are fully confident that he can substantially add to the company's successful performance and to the further strengthening of our position in the polyolefins market."

"Borealis is making significant investments in the polyolefins industry and expanding its business in Europe, as well as in the Middle East and Asia," adds Delorenzi. "We have an excellent team at Borealis who is ready for the challenges that this offers and I look forward to driving our Value Creation through Innovation strategy forward with them."
